pkgsrc-Changes-HG arch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
[pkgsrc/trunk]: pkgsrc/sysutils/gkrellm Merge after gkrellm2 import.
details: https://anonhg.NetBSD.org/pkgsrc/rev/dfe8604dde44
branches: trunk
changeset: 469558:dfe8604dde44
user: cube <cube%pkgsrc.org@localhost>
date: Wed Feb 25 00:36:11 2004 +0000
description:
Merge after gkrellm2 import.
diffstat:
sysutils/gkrellm/Makefile | 56 ++++++++++++++++++++++++----------------------
1 files changed, 29 insertions(+), 27 deletions(-)
diffs (69 lines):
diff -r 20f9fb840119 -r dfe8604dde44 sysutils/gkrellm/Makefile
--- a/sysutils/gkrellm/Makefile Wed Feb 25 00:25:02 2004 +0000
+++ b/sysutils/gkrellm/Makefile Wed Feb 25 00:36:11 2004 +0000
@@ -1,36 +1,38 @@
-# $NetBSD: Makefile,v 1.27 2004/01/24 15:06:57 grant Exp $
-#
+# $NetBSD: Makefile,v 1.28 2004/02/25 00:36:11 cube Exp $
+.include "Makefile.common"
+
+GKRELLM_PKGBASE= gkrellm
+WRKSRC= ${GKRELLM_SRCDIR}
-DISTNAME= gkrellm-1.2.13
-PKGREVISION= 3
-CATEGORIES= sysutils
-MASTER_SITES= http://web.wt.net/~billw/gkrellm/
-EXTRACT_SUFX= .tar.bz2
+COMMENT= GTK2 based system monitor
+
+DEPENDS+= gkrellm-share-${GKRELLM_VERSION}:../../sysutils/gkrellm-share
-MAINTAINER= anthony.mallet%ficus.yi.org@localhost
-HOMEPAGE= http://gkrellm.net/
-COMMENT= GTK based system monitor
+USE_BUILDLINK3= YES
+USE_X11= YES
+USE_PKGINSTALL= YES
-BUILD_USES_MSGFMT= YES
+.include "../../mk/bsd.prefs.mk"
+
+.if (${OPSYS} == "NetBSD" || ${OPSYS} == "FreeBSD" || ${OPSYS} == "OpenBSD")
+SPECIAL_PERMS+= ${PREFIX}/bin/gkrellm ${ROOT_USER} kmem 2711
+.endif
-OSVERSION_SPECIFIC= YES
-USE_BUILDLINK2= YES
-USE_X11= YES
-USE_GNU_TOOLS+= make
-USE_PKGLOCALEDIR= YES
+NOT_FOR_PLATFORM= IRIX-*
+
+MAKE_ENV+= MODULES=src LINK_FLAGS=${EXPORT_SYMBOLS_LDFLAGS}
-ALL_TARGET= netbsd
-INSTALL_TARGET= install_netbsd
-
-MAKE_ENV+= PTHREAD_INC="-I${LOCALBASE}/include"
-MAKE_ENV+= EXPORT_SYMBOLS_LDFLAGS="${EXPORT_SYMBOLS_LDFLAGS}"
+pre-build:
+ ${SED} -e s,@@PREFIX@@,${PREFIX}, <${WRKSRC}/src/gkrellm.h >${WRKSRC}/src/gkrellm.h.sed
+ ${MV} ${WRKSRC}/src/gkrellm.h.sed ${WRKSRC}/src/gkrellm.h
post-install:
- ${INSTALL_DATA_DIR} ${PREFIX}/share/gkrellm
- ${INSTALL_DATA} ${WRKSRC}/README ${PREFIX}/share/gkrellm
- ${INSTALL_DATA_DIR} ${PREFIX}/lib/gkrellm
- ${INSTALL_DATA_DIR} ${PREFIX}/lib/gkrellm/plugins
- ${INSTALL_DATA_DIR} ${PREFIX}/share/gkrellm/themes
+ ${INSTALL_DATA_DIR} ${PREFIX}/lib/gkrellm2
+ ${INSTALL_DATA_DIR} ${PREFIX}/lib/gkrellm2/plugins
+ ${INSTALL_DATA_DIR} ${PREFIX}/share/gkrellm2/themes
-.include "../../graphics/imlib/buildlink2.mk"
+.include "../../x11/gtk2/buildlink3.mk"
+.include "../../devel/glib2/buildlink3.mk"
+.include "../../security/openssl/buildlink3.mk"
+
.include "../../mk/bsd.pkg.mk"
Home |
Main Index |
Thread Index |
Old Index